Geographic Range & Migration

Tapajos Hermit

Found in the Amazon basin in Brazil, primarily along the Tapajós River and its tributaries. Resident in humid lowland forest undergrowth.

Allen's Hummingbird

Breeds along the Pacific coast from Oregon to southern California. Partial migrant; some Channel Islands populations resident year-round.

About These Birds

Tapajos Hermit

A small hermit hummingbird (10-11 cm) found along the Tapajós River basin in central Brazil. Green plumage with rufous underparts. Nectarivore of forest undergrowth. Recently described as a species distinct from other Phaethornis hermits based on vocal and plumage differences.

Allen's Hummingbird

A small hummingbird (8-9 cm) breeding along the Pacific coast from Oregon to southern California. Males have an orange-red throat and rufous flanks. Closely related to Rufous Hummingbird. Partial migrant; some populations resident on Channel Islands. Named after Thomas Allen.
